What is Social Commerce?

Visit Social Commerce is the ability to sell directly within social media platforms without requiring users to leave the app. Unlike traditional social marketing, which redirects consumers to external websites, Social Commerce integrates the shopping experience into the platform itself, offering unmatched ease and instant purchasing.

Here’s how it works on the major platforms:

Instagram Shop:

  • With Instagram Shop, products can be tagged in posts and stories, allowing users to click on a product tag, view details, and check out without ever leaving Instagram—a perfect example of how to sell on Instagram seamlessly.

TikTok Shop:

  • With TikTok’s rapid growth, instant shopping directly from your feed is a game-changer. Brands can integrate their catalogs, enabling users to purchase viral products they see in their favorite creators’ videos. This makes shopping on TikTok fast, simple, and highly effective.

Facebook Shops :

  • Facebook Shops allow businesses to create customizable, integrated storefronts directly on their business pages. It centralizes product displays and streamlines sales across the entire Meta ecosystem.

Shopping on Instagram or TikTok is becoming as natural as liking a photo. For brands, this is an opportunity to capture the impulse to buy at the exact moment it arises, driving sales directly through social platforms.

Why Social Commerce Works So Well

The success of Social Commerce is rooted in a simple consumer psychology: people love convenience and speed. In a world where attention spans are short, every second spent loading an external page risks losing a potential customer.

Here are the key reasons why Social Commerce is so effective:

  1. Instant conversion : Sales happen when interest is at its peak. By eliminating unnecessary steps (like clicking a link in bio, waiting for a site to load, and searching for the product), you maximize your chances of closing the sale. It’s one of the best ways to boost conversions on social media.
  2. Social Proof: Purchase decisions are heavily influenced by social validation. Seeing a friend or influencer using a product builds trust instantly. Social trends and recommendations act as powerful decision-making triggers.
  3. Native experience : Shopping is integrated into the entertainment experience. Users don’t feel “sold to”; instead, they feel like they’re discovering something that enhances their experience.

To increase social conversions, it’s not enough to just be present—you need to understand that the social context is a lever for trust and urgency. Strategies for Social Commerce success focus on optimizing content and targeting intent behind every interaction.

Best Practices for Social Commerce Success

Succeeding in social media sales requires more than just activating a shop—it calls for an adapted content strategy and regular optimization.

Eye-Catching Visuals

On visual platforms, high-quality imagery is non-negotiable. Use bold, engaging visuals for Social Commerce. Your photos and videos should not only showcase the product but also put it in context. A TikTok demo video or a lifestyle shot on Instagram will perform far better than a plain product photo. The aesthetic should immediately inspire a purchase.

Clear Product Descriptions

With limited space and short attention spans, keep your descriptions clear and compelling. Use strong headlines and concise text to quickly highlight key benefits and features (size, material, use) without overwhelming the user.

Exclusive Promotions

Urgency is a powerful driver of sales. Leverage exclusive promotions for your social media followers to encourage immediate purchases. Flash sales or limited-time discount codes work especially well to trigger action and create a competitive edge.

Monitor and Optimize

Tracking and analyzing your sales data is crucial. Periodically review the data collected to understand what works. Which products sell best on Instagram? What type of TikTok video drives the most clicks?

Optimizing Social Commerce content involves A/B testing. Test different formats (carousel posts vs. reels), messaging, and calls-to-action to maximize conversions. With the help of analytics tools, you can implement a concrete plan to refine these variables continuously, showing how to increase social media sales effectively.
